Instance Method Details
#camel_case(underscored_name) ⇒ Object
12 13 14 |
# File 'lib/aruba/event_bus/name_resolver.rb', line 12 def camel_case(underscored_name) underscored_name.to_s.split('_').map { |word| word.upcase[0] + word[1..-1] }.join end |
